  • 2004-2010年,上海交通大学-美国加州大学戴维斯分校,博士学位

  • 2008-2009年,美国加州大学戴维斯分校,联合培养博士生

  • 2010-2013年,上海交通大学,助理研究员

  • 2012-2013年,日本国立物质材料研究所,博后

  • 2013-2014年,德国马普所胶体与界面研究所,洪堡博士后

  • 2014-2019年,上海交通大学材料学院,讲师、副教授

  • 2019年7月-至今,上海交通大学材料学院,教授

  • AI驱动超材料设计、智能超材料、仿生材料
